Reassuring the former Finance Minister Ishaq Dar that he will be issued a protective bail, the Supreme Court (SC) has summoned Dar to court and has given him till evening to submit his reply.

Resuming the hearing pertaining to the nomination papers of Dar on Tuesday, the Chief Justice of Pakistan (CJP) Saqib Nisar asked the whereabouts of the former finance minister. When he was informed by Dar’s counsel Salman Aslam Butt that Dar was ill and currently in London, the CJP replied that a person could not be sick for this long, local media reported.

Saying that SC cannot issue a notice to Dar again, the CJP has given Dar’s counsel time till 8pm in the evening to submit Dar’s reply.

On March 9, Pakistan Peoples Party candidate Nawaz Pirzada had challenged the senate membership of Dar by filing a petition in the top court. In his petition, Pirzada stated that Dar had been declared as a proclaimed offender by an accountability court and therefore, he could not be elected as a Senate member.

On March 3, Dar had won a technocrat seat as a Pakistan Muslim League-Nawaz backed independent candidate.

Dar has been absconding his corruption hearing since last year. The National Accountability Bureau has filed corruption reference against Dar for owing assets beyond his known source of income, after the Panama Papers revelation.
